This Friday, the international U20 basketball tournament, Laure Écard, kicks off. Four major nations will compete over three days of very high-level play.
Happy Birthday! This year, the international U20 basketball tournament Laure Écard celebrates its 10th anniversary. A tournament of a “very high level,” according to Éric Ciotti, who adds that the tournament features “four very fine teams” again this year. This tournament is an opportunity to “share a high-quality sporting moment” in memory of a name, that of Laure Écard.
Who among France and Russia, triple winners of the tournament, Belgium, or Australia, the world’s second-ranked women’s basketball nation, participating for the first time in this competition, will come out on top?
Belgium was defeated by Australia (44-55) in the tournament’s opening match.
